Key Features of the Apartment Fire Safety Checklist

The checklist comprises several key components necessary for a thorough assessment of fire safety equipment in the property. It includes sections for items such as smoke detectors and fire extinguishers, ensuring thorough inspections of essential fire safety measures. The format of the form contains checkboxes, spaces for inspection dates, and areas for notes, making it easy to use and maintain. Additionally, specific sections cover attic firewall inspections and general safety measures for comprehensive coverage.

Apartment managers and property management companies in Texas are required to complete the Apartment Fire Safety Checklist to comply with local fire safety regulations and ensure tenant safety.
The checklist includes sections for inspecting smoke detectors, fire extinguishers, attic firewalls, and other essential fire safety measures needed for apartment complexes.
It's recommended that apartment managers conduct an inspection and complete the checklist at least once a year or more frequently if required by fire safety regulations.
No, notarization is not required for the Apartment Fire Safety Checklist. It is a fillable form meant for internal use by property management.
If you identify any fire safety issues during the inspection, make sure to document them on the checklist and take corrective actions based on urgency and compliance requirements.
